sub-category under 2 different categories ?

In my paper and pencil rpg site, link to the left in profile, I have a Forest in different nation categories. I want to add the same forest as a sub-category to both nations. When I go to create it a second time, on the Category page, it says it already exists.

Is there a way to do this ?

Thanks.

Re: sub-category under 2 different categories ?

You could change the title of each category to be the same; Txp will allow that. That might not do what you want, though, because the title is just for show; behind the scenes the name is what counts. Bizarrely, category name, not ID, is what gets stored in the articles (textpattern) table.

You could also edit the category names directly in the database. I doubt this is a good idea, because of how article categories are stored by name instead of ID.

Category handling is an area where even Txp die-hards will admit Txp is lacking.
